Pituffik/ Thule Air Base vs Ceara Mirim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Pituffik/ Thule Air Base, Greenland and Ceara Mirim, Brazil is approximately 9,383 km or 5,831 mi.
  • To reach Pituffik/ Thule Air Base in this distance one would set out from Ceara Mirim bearing 352.6°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Pituffik/ Thule Air Base bearing 326.7° or NNW .
  • Pituffik/ Thule Air Base has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Ceara Mirim has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ry summers (As).
  • Pituffik/ Thule Air Base is in or near the polar desert biome whereas Ceara Mirim is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 36.6 °C (65.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 26.1 °C (47°F) more in Pituffik/ Thule Air Base.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1137.1 mm (44.8 in) less which is equivalent to 1137.1 l/m² (27.91 US gal/ft²) or 11,371,000 l/ha (1,215,635 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 60.4° lower in Pituffik/ Thule Air Base than in Ceara Mirim.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.8%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 37.3°C (67.1°F) lower.
